write difference between straited non straited and cardiac muscle​

Striated muscle

They are cylindrical in shape and multi nucleate

They are present in body parts such as hands and legs.

Unstriated muscle

They spindle shaped and uninucleate.

They are present in the wall of food canal, stomach, mouth, iris etc.

Cardiac muscle

They are cylindrical branched and uninucleate

They are present in the heart.
